8. Exposure Controls / Personal Protection
Exposure Standards
Material
TWA ppm
TWA mg/m³
STEL ppm
STEL mg/m³
121-69-7 N,N-dimethylaniline
5ppm
25mg/m³
10ppm
50mg/m³

9. Physical and Chemical Properties
General information
Appearance
Light yellow liquid
Odour
Characteristic
pH
7.4
Vapour Pressure
1hPa at 30°C
Density
0.956g/cm³ at 20°C
Boiling Point
193°C
Melting Point
1.5°C
Solubility
Fully miscible
Specific Gravity of Density
Not available
Flash Point
75°C
Flammable (Explosive) Limits
Lower: 1 Vol%
Upper: 7 Vol%
Ignition Temperature
370°C
Formula
C6H5N(CH3)2

11. Toxicological Information
Acute effects
Oral LD50 1410 mg/kg (rat)
Dermal LD50 1770 mg/kg (rabbit)
